    Electric front load whirlpool dryer belt
    Our belt broke on our electric front load Whirlpool dryer. We pulled it out. How can we change it?

    Remove the power lead from the socket and put it on the floor in front of you. Safety first.
    Open up the rear of the dryer.
    Put a new belt around the drum.
    Guide the bottom of the belt around the driving wheel of the motor.
    Loop the belt around the spring loaded tension wheel.
    Test if functioning properly.
